哪位大神怎么用帆软公式计算一个月排班中连续排班的最多的天数?

数据.7z

A1.jpeg

例如:上图连续排班天数为5天;

FineReport PILGRIM 发布于 2022-10-28 11:13 (编辑于 2022-10-28 11:33)
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共3回答
最佳回答
0
Z4u3z1Lv6专家互助
发布于2022-10-28 14:23(编辑于 2022-10-28 14:24)

数据.zip

image.png

image.png

----------

和楼上类似用了数组

  • PILGRIM PILGRIM(提问者) 你的我试了一下,发现好像不行,现在没找到哪里的问题
    2022-10-31 17:04 
  • Z4u3z1 Z4u3z1 回复 PILGRIM(提问者) 模板传了的 你比对一下 。注意父格
    2022-10-31 17:08 
最佳回答
1
杨朝健Lv5中级互助
发布于2022-10-28 14:08(编辑于 2022-10-31 19:13)

max(maparray(split(joinarray(D2:AH2,","),"[(free)]"),count(split(item,"[(D)(N)]"))-1))

image.png

  • CD20160914 CD20160914 大佬这思路学习了。
    2022-10-28 14:14 
  • PILGRIM PILGRIM(提问者) 大佬,假如不全是N班,比如\"DNNNN\"该怎么改呢?
    2022-10-31 17:03 
  • 杨朝健 杨朝健 回复 PILGRIM(提问者) 看修改答案
    2022-10-31 19:13 
最佳回答
0
CD20160914Lv8专家互助
发布于2022-10-28 11:21

传一下文件看一下?文件》输出》内置数据。最好有3-5行数据。说清楚每一行要的结果?

  • PILGRIM PILGRIM(提问者) 数据文件已添加;EXCEL的公式是MAX(FREQUENCY(IF(D2:AH2<>\"free\",COLUMN(D2:AH2),IF(D2:AH2=\"free\",COLUMN(D2:AH2))))
    2022-10-28 11:35 
  • CD20160914 CD20160914 回复 PILGRIM(提问者) 我先看一下。。。
    2022-10-28 11:38 
  • CD20160914 CD20160914 回复 PILGRIM(提问者) 想了很久,没有思路,得到了数据。但是转换不出来。如何判断最多连续的。。这个问题好像一直是个难点在帆软,抱歉
    2022-10-28 13:33 
  • 3关注人数
  • 653浏览人数
  • 最后回答于:2022-10-31 19:13
    请选择关闭问题的原因
    确定 取消
    返回顶部